Bug description:
  I'm not sure why it started failing all of a sudden. Must be because some dependency was dropped elsewhere, since lftp was always linked with zlib.
  (...)
  checking if zlib is wanted... yes
  checking for inflateEnd in -lz... no
  checking zlib.h usability... no
  checking zlib.h presence... no
  checking for zlib.h... no
  configure: error: cannot find -lz library, install zlib-devel package
  make: *** [debian/rules:24: configure-stamp] Error 1
  dpkg-buildpackage: error: debian/rules build subprocess returned exit status 2
